Biography

US rap group 2 Live Crew are likely to be remembered for the controversy, surrounding As Nasty as They Wanna Be, rather than the music. The band popularised the Miami sound of simple, raunchy lyrics and a booming bass sound, sometimes described as booty rap.

First and foremost- DO NOT TAKE THIS ALBUM SERIOUSLY! This is by-far the premire 2 Live Crew album to own. Almost every track is worthy of being on their greatest hits CD. Some stand-outs: Move Somethin'... is a FANTASIC song with exceptional rapping, good hooks, and great style; One and One... the catchiest and perhaps most hilarious of all the songs 2 Live has produced; S&M... the best song 2 Live has ever created, an anthem for all bachelor and frat parties for years to come. Again, this is a highly offensive, disgusting, and idiotic record... however, if you take it as it was designed to be interpreted, this album is funny-as-heck! THIS IS NOT BACH. Oh, yeah, this album would be 5 stars, although, I had to give it four so that I wouldn't consider myself completely foolish.

Move Somethin' is 2 Live Crew's second studio release.
Brother Marquis, Fresh Kid Ice, Mr. Mixx, and Luke Skyywalkerhave been a member of 2 Live Crew.
